Map Location
Bellworth Developments Sdn. Bhd.
11A, Jalan Wan Kadir 2, Taman Tun Dr. Ismail, Kuala Lumpur, 60000, Kuala Lumpur, WP Kuala Lumpur, Malaysia
Open in Ask AI
Open in Google Maps